Deribasovskaya street
Russian poet Nikolai Zabolotny called Deribasovskaya street "the queen of all streets in the world".
Deribasovskaya street is the favorite street of Odessa citizens and its guests. Many historical evens are connected with it.
The street is quintessential Odessa, in concentrated form. Here each square centimeter of pavement holds within it happy memories.
It as named after Admiral de Ribas, the first governor and benefactor of Odessa.
Deribasovskaya street is more then a name, it is a touchstone, a fairy-tale character, a figure of speech.
From the mouths of Odessa inhabitants the expression "Now, I'll take a running jump from Deribasovskaya street" means contemptuous refusal.
The words "I'd kiss the stone of Deribasovskaya street" expresses extreme nostalgia,
and to "meander along Deribasovskaya street" is one of the best ways to pass some carefree hours.
Deribasovskaya street boasts numerous cafes, restaurants, bars and eateries of all seasons, alluring shop windows and film posters.
The street has been closed to traffic for 15 years and is a favorite walking area in Odessa.
The street leads to the City Garden, the oldest of the many parks and gardens that grace Odessa today.
The balcony of the "Utoch-Kino" cinema is decorated with the sculpted figure of Sergei Utochkin,
a legendary Odessan athlete, aviation pioneer and a champion cyclist.
